How much does Michigan Youth ChalleNGe Academy cost?

How much does Michigan Youth ChalleNGe Academy cost?

Meals, housing and uniforms are all provided and there are no costs to the cadet or their families for participation in the program. The Academy is paid for by the U.S. Department of Defense and the State of Michigan.

Is Michigan Youth Challenge Academy free?

The Michigan Youth Challenge Academy is a no cost, bi-annual, 5-and-a-half-month residential quasi-military academic program based in Battle Creek, Michigan, just east of Kalamazoo. The academy is a 100 percent volunteer attendance program, but cadets who do attend learn valuable life skills.

ETA’s Reentry Employment Opportunities program funded YC programs in Georgia, Michigan, and South Carolina to include more court-involved youth and add a follow-on 20-week residential occupational training program called Job Challenge (JC).

What is the youngest age you can go to boarding school?

United States. In the United States, boarding schools for students below the age of 13 are called junior boarding schools, and are relatively uncommon. The oldest junior boarding school is the Fay School in Southborough, Massachusetts, established in 1866.

How much does it cost to send your kid to military school?

How Much is Military School Tuition? Tuition at most college preparatory military boarding schools ranges from about $25,000 to $50,000 per year. Military schools are a great value when compared to traditional boarding schools, where the median tuition price is over $53,000 .
